Deer and wildlife are drawn to farmland, so it's important to invest in a humane and effective barrier. Our deer fences combine durable wood posts with smooth, tightly woven metal mesh for a low-maintenance solution. Most deer fences are 6 to 8 feet tall to deter deer from leaping over them when running across properties.
Create a sturdy enclosure or mark your perimeter with a post and board fence. This classic farm fence style features 3 or 4 horizontal rails and vertical posts for a charming look. It's excellent for creating horse paddocks, enclosures, or perimeter fences. You can strengthen its protection by adding a layer of wire mesh fabric.
If you like a rustic, log-fence style, you'll love split rail fences. This distinctive style uses split or rough-cut wood boards, each carrying the unique character of the wood it was made from. The signature X-shape of crossbuck fencing comes from two overlapping wood boards attached to the rails. This attractive layout enhances the fence's strength and stability, allowing it to withstand force and pressure from everyday agricultural activities. A well-built crossbuck fence can also add curb appeal to your property.
Strong horizontal wood boards and rails form the basis of a Kentucky Board fence. You can enhance the design by adding rust-resistant metal wire to keep animals safe on either side. These versatile, durable fences are low-maintenance and long-lasting. Use them to create safe enclosures and mark your pasture's perimeter.
Pipe fencing is a strong choice for securing cattle. Its rust-resistant finish and durable material mean it can withstand pressure for years without giving in or leaning. The complete visibility of pipe fencing also helps you view your surroundings. We can customize your fence to create alleys to chutes, divide pastures, and more.
Vinyl rail fences add the look and charm of a classic wood rail fence with less maintenance. Vinyl's durability makes it an excellent option for enclosing large properties. Its beautiful finishes are met with reliable strength that can easily contain horses, alpacas, and smaller animals such as goats and sheep.
Steel rail fencing combines the look of wood rail fences with the toughness of rust-resistant steel. The sleek, polished finish gives you a beautiful, durable farm fence that doesn't rot, warp, or attract pests. Most steel rail fences are made from galvanized steel and have a powder-coated finish for maximum protection.
A classic barbed wire fence is excellent for keeping animals secure and wildlife at a distance. You can easily tailor the barbed wire by selecting the appropriate metal gauge and spacing between each strand. Wire mesh fencing doesn't have the sharp edges of barbed wire, making it safer and more versatile in farm fencing. This fence type is excellent for small animal enclosures for ducks, chickens, and even goats, perimeter fencing, or crop protection. Wire mesh fencing ensures continued safety and clear visibility in any setting.
Thanks to the high-tensile wire, poly-coat fences are excellent for horses and cattle. The color of the wire's coating makes the animals less likely to run into the fence, while the smooth finish minimizes the risk of injury upon contact. Poly coat fences are weather-resistant and last for years with minimal maintenance.
We can modify different styles of wire fencing to administer a humane electrical shock upon contact. Agricultural properties with large cattle often find electric fencing to be a helpful strategy for keeping their livestock safely contained.
